Lending Club has created a new television commercial. It was produced by Marketing Architects and is targeted at bringing more borrowers on to the platform. The ad is in testing right now and has been since late August.
According to Lending Club the ad will run nationally and right now they are testing it in different markets on local news, daytime television as well as late night. The ad encourages viewers to go to this URL: www.TryLendingClub.com which takes people to a custom landing page on Lending Club’s site where they can closely track the business it generates. So far Lending Club has said simply that they are “testing TV and evaluating the performance of the ad” but they declined to elaborate more.
Prosper has run some TV ads in the past as has Lending Club but those campaigns were some time ago now. I don’t blame them for giving TV another try and I commend them for tracking it so closely. These are no brand awareness ads that are very difficult to track; Lending Club will be able to determine exactly how much new business this brings in.
